@ShokLeague5 ай бұрын
Have some rougher games coming up! And yes, ideally Jayce should push top wave all the way to the enemy T2 tower and then come down to drag. It's too early in the game to be sacrificing lots of waves top for a relatively unimportant dragon, so if he can't get the wave into the enemy T2 tower then he should just stay top (and take T2 if aatrox runs to dragon)

@ShokLeague4 ай бұрын
This is gold, it's called unranked to master for a reason. Comet/First strike are good for early game but they make teamfighting so difficult, I don't think it's good on Ryze unless it's the difference between getting prio over your lane or not. Archangel rush is not bad for soloq I think, ROA hp is very useful vs assassins though.
